Oracle 12c RAC安装与运维实战指南
需积分: 39 50 浏览量
更新于2024-07-15
收藏 2.61MB PDF 举报
"Oracle 12c RAC安装与运维说明手册"
Oracle 12c Real Application Clusters (RAC) 是Oracle数据库的一种高可用性和性能优化解决方案,它允许多个实例同时访问同一个物理数据库,从而提供高并发处理能力和故障切换能力。本手册详细介绍了在Linux操作系统环境下进行Oracle 12c RAC的安装与运维步骤,适用于系统管理员和数据库管理员进行参考。
1. **安装前准备**
在安装Oracle 12c RAC之前,需要对系统进行一系列的预配置工作,包括:
- 修改`grid`和`oracle`用户的`.profile`文件,设置正确的环境变量,确保这两个用户能够正确地访问和使用Oracle软件。
2. **安装Grid介质**
Grid Infrastructure是Oracle RAC的基础,包含Clusterware和ASM(Automatic Storage Management)。这部分指南将详细阐述:
- 安装过程:如何通过响应文件和图形界面进行安装,包括设置网络、存储和集群配置。
- 确认安装结果:检查Cluster Health Advisor (CHA) 和 Cluster Registry (CRS) 等组件是否正常运行。
3. **安装Oracle介质**
在所有RAC节点上安装数据库软件,确保所有节点上的环境一致:
- 参考资料:可能需要的文档、补丁或官方指南。
- 安装软件:按照特定顺序和步骤安装Oracle数据库软件。
4. **创建DiskGroup及数据库**
- 创建DiskGroup:使用ASM创建存储磁盘组,用于存放数据库的数据文件、控制文件和日志文件等。
- 创建数据库:通过Database Configuration Assistant (DBCA) 创建RAC数据库,配置数据库实例、数据文件的位置等。
- 更改监听端口:在不同节点上,为每个数据库实例配置不同的监听端口,避免冲突。
- 重新配置redo log:调整redo log文件的大小和位置,以适应高并发环境。
- 配置数据库参数:根据应用需求,调整数据库参数,如SGA大小、pga_aggregate_target等。
- 控制文件配置:确保控制文件的冗余和安全性,可配置多路复用和镜像。
- 归档模式:根据业务需求,开启或关闭数据库的归档模式,以实现数据保护。
- 用户密码策略:配置用户密码生命周期和审计功能,以增强安全性。
5. **创建数据库表空间和数据表**
- 上传脚本:将本地的SQL脚本上传至服务器,用于创建表空间、用户、表和初始数据。
- 执行脚本:分别对系统管理、统计计费和监控平台的脚本进行执行,包括:
- 创建表空间和用户
- 创建基础表
- 初始化基础数据
- 分配用户权限
6. **运维**
在完成安装后,运维工作包括监控数据库性能、维护数据库健康、定期备份、故障排查和修复等。本手册可能还涵盖了日常运维的最佳实践和常见问题解决方案。
本手册详细且全面,覆盖了从安装到运维的全过程,对于希望掌握Oracle 12c RAC的读者来说,是一份宝贵的参考资料。在实际操作时,应结合官方文档和手册,以及适当的实践经验,以确保RAC环境的稳定和高效。
2023-11-11 上传
2023-07-09 上传
2023-09-27 上传
2023-05-31 上传
2023-12-21 上传
2023-10-16 上传
worthcvt
- 粉丝: 91
- 资源: 407
最新资源
- JDK 17 Linux版本压缩包解压与安装指南
- C++/Qt飞行模拟器教员控制台系统源码发布
- TensorFlow深度学习实践:CNN在MNIST数据集上的应用
- 鸿蒙驱动HCIA资料整理-培训教材与开发者指南
- 凯撒Java版SaaS OA协同办公软件v2.0特性解析
- AutoCAD二次开发中文指南下载 - C#编程深入解析
- C语言冒泡排序算法实现详解
- Pointofix截屏:轻松实现高效截图体验
- Matlab实现SVM数据分类与预测教程
- 基于JSP+SQL的网站流量统计管理系统设计与实现
- C语言实现删除字符中重复项的方法与技巧
- e-sqlcipher.dll动态链接库的作用与应用
- 浙江工业大学自考网站开发与继续教育官网模板设计
- STM32 103C8T6 OLED 显示程序实现指南
- 高效压缩技术:删除重复字符压缩包
- JSP+SQL智能交通管理系统:违章处理与交通效率提升